Den nya versionen av OpenZFS 2.1 har redan släppts och levereras med dRAID-support, kompatibilitetsförbättringar och mer.

Lanseringen av den nya versionen av OpenZFS 2.1-projektet tillkännagavs och i den nya versionen presenteras flera förbättringar, av vilka den viktigaste förändringen i den här versionen är det extra stödet för dRAID.

För dem som inte känner till OpenZFS, bör du veta att detta tillhandahåller en implementering av komponenterna av ZFS relaterade till både filsystemet och volymhanteraren. Särskilt, följande komponenter implementeras: SPA (Storage Pool Allocator), DMU (Data Management Unit), ZVOL (ZFS Emulated Volume) och ZPL (ZFS POSIX Layer).

Dessutom har projektet oDet erbjuder möjligheten att använda ZFS som en backend för det klusterade filsystemet Luster. Projektarbete baseras på original ZFS-kod importerad från OpenSolaris-projektet och förbättrad med förbättringar och korrigeringar från Illumos-communityn. Projektet utvecklas med deltagande av personal från Livermore National Laboratory under kontrakt med USA: s energiministerium.

Koden distribueras under gratis CDDL-licens, vilket är oförenligt med GPLv2, vilket inte tillåter att integrera OpenZFS i uppströms Linux-kärnan, eftersom det inte är tillåtet att blanda kod under GPLv2- och CDDL-licenser. För att ta itu med denna licensinkompatibilitet beslutades att distribuera hela produkten under CDDL-licensen som en separat nedladdningsbar modul som levereras separat från kärnan. Stabiliteten i OpenZFS-kodbasen anses vara jämförbar med andra FS för Linux.

De viktigaste nya funktionerna i OpenZFS 2.1

I den här nya versionen den viktigaste nyheten som presenteras är stödet för dRAID-teknik (Distribuerad reserv RAID), med vilken du kan skapa grupper med en ny distribuerad variant av RAIDZ som möjliggör dramatiskt snabbare återställningstider med hjälp av integrerade heta reservdelar. DRAID virtuella lagring består av flera interna RAIDZ-grupper, som var och en innehåller lagringsenheter och enheter för lagring av paritetsblock. Dessa grupper är utspridda över alla enheter för att utnyttja tillgänglig diskbredd optimalt. Istället för en separat hot-recovery disk använder dRAID konceptet att logiskt fördela block för hot-recovery över alla diskar i en array.

En annan av de förändringar som sticker ut är kompatibilitetsegenskap, eftersom det nu tillåter administratörer att ange vilken uppsättning funktioner som ska aktiveras i gruppen. Denna detaljerade kontroll gör det enkelt att skapa bärbara grupper och upprätthåller gruppkompatibilitet över OpenZFS-versioner och över plattformar.

Dessutom kan vi också hitta det gav möjlighet att spara statistik om gruppprestanda i InfluxDB-databasformatet optimerad för att lagra, analysera och manipulera data i form av tidsserier (delar av parametervärden vid angivna tidsintervall). För att exportera till InfluxDB-format erbjuds kommandot "zpool_influxdb".

Förutom egenskapen för «kompatibilitet skapar zpool -u som inaktiverar de automatiska monteringarna,« zpool-historik -i »- reflektion i driftshistoriken under varaktigheten för varje kommandos körning,« zpool-status »i den som tillagts en varning om diskar med en suboptimal blockstorlek och "zfs rename -u" som byter namn på filsystemet utan att montera om det.

Av de andra förändringarna som sticker ut av denna nya version:

  • Förbättrad interaktiv I / O-prestanda.
  • Förbättrad prestationshämtningsprestanda för arbetsbelastningar för parallell dataåtkomst
  • Förbättrad skalbarhet genom att minska låskonflikten.
  • Minskad importtid för poolen.
  • Omfattande modernisering av man-sidor
  • Minskad fragmentering av ZIL-block.
  • Förbättrad prestanda för rekursiva operationer.
  • Automatiserad ABI-validering har lagts till för gränssnitt för offentliga bibliotek
  • Förbättrad minneshantering.
  • Kärnmodulens laddning har påskyndats.

Slutligen om du är intresserad av att veta mer om det, kan du kontrollera detaljer i följande länk.


Lämna din kommentar

Din e-postadress kommer inte att publiceras. Obligatoriska fält är markerade med *

*

*

  1. Ansvarig för data: AB Internet Networks 2008 SL
  2. Syftet med uppgifterna: Kontrollera skräppost, kommentarhantering.
  3. Legitimering: Ditt samtycke
  4. Kommunikation av uppgifterna: Uppgifterna kommer inte att kommuniceras till tredje part förutom enligt laglig skyldighet.
  5. Datalagring: databas värd för Occentus Networks (EU)
  6. Rättigheter: När som helst kan du begränsa, återställa och radera din information.